There is no secret that when it comes to debilitating condition, Parkinson's disease among the worst.
diagnosis of this condition is particularly devastating because the prognosis is usually grim. There is a procedure, however, which has been proven to help patients cope with their symptoms. It is known as deep brain stimulation (DBS). Doctors treat tremors, rigidity and tremor associated with Parkinson's disease by implanting neurostimulators that activate parts of the brain that control movement.
